The University of Ghana Business School (UGBS) is committed to educating business leaders who are able to evolve innovative solutions to challenges confronting both the public and private sectors in Africa and beyond, promoting theory and practice and also making a positive impact on the business community and society. The Corporate Executives in Residence Programme (CERP) fosters these goals by inviting seasoned executives to share their rich experience and insights with our students, faculty and school management. The CERP is in line with UGBS’ strategy of bringing research and practice together. Particular attention is paid to the design of the CERP to ensure academic excellence by making it possible for UGBS’ students, staff, faculty and management to meet and interact with experienced and accomplished professionals from various sectors of the business community.
The corporate executives in residence serve for at least a semester, and during this time, visit campus two or three times to interact with students, deliver guest lectures and seminars, and provide career guidance. The CERP provides the platform through which the School can engage with the business community. This engagement is not only necessary but also beneficial, given the positive impact the CERP is likely to have on students, staff, faculty and management of UGBS.
